Behind the scenes of 911 communications

In the tapestry of emergency response, there exists a cadre of unsung heroes who work tirelessly behind the scenes, guiding callers through what may seem like their darkest hour. These individuals, often referred to as “headset heroes,” are the men and women of 911 who exhibit extraordinary leadership and compassion in the face of adversity. As the Director of 911 services, I am compelled to shine a spotlight on their invaluable contributions to our community and acknowledge the profound impact they have on the lives of those they serve.

Every day, our 911 Communications Specialists stand at the frontline of emergency response, fielding calls from individuals in distress, crisis, and need. They possess an innate ability to remain calm under pressure, providing reassurance and guidance to callers during some of the most harrowing moments of their lives. Whether it’s a medical emergency, a natural disaster, or a threat to personal safety, our 911 Communications Specialists are unwavering in their commitment to serving the needs of our community with professionalism, empathy, and unwavering dedication.
